MBFS made the mistake of sending me a survey asking about my experience with their company.... I almost feel sorry for all the customer service agents I've spoke with over the last few weeks. How the hell can MBFS deny an applicant on my lease takeover when their credit score is better than mine, they have less debt than I do AND they got approved to lease a new C63 with a higher price tag? Thats not customer service, thats customer rape. So frustrated!
Reply 0
Jul 22, 2014 | 06:44 PM
  #63  
It's business unfortunately
They have you under contract
If the other guy really wants one they have one for him too

If they transfer they have 1 lease, which they already have
If they get him a new one they have 2
2 > 1 lol so what's in it for MB?
It's about the numbers not favors
Capitalism does have some small personal downsides

I was denied on a lease take over through MBFS with credit score of 820+, 0 debt, and a great salary. Ended up receiving a letter with the reason line blank, I called them up and they basically offered me to work with a dealer to lease a new one. I already had my 507 on order and took delivery the same day it showed up.
Reply 0
Jul 23, 2014 | 09:43 AM
  #66  
OC6.3AMG, great numbers but do you have a credit card, most companies like to see some relationship with credit cards, you buy, you pay off on a timely basis. Also some debt is actually good as that show them a history of usage and compliance. Had a small issue when my son was buying a Cadillac CTS, his second Cad and they refused him even though his first was through the same bank with the car paid in full two years prior to this purchase, what it came down to was he had no debt or did not have any credit cards, other than the paid off loan for the first caddy and worked for the same company for 5 years. They finally resigned him after some intervention from Dad, 2.9% for 36 months, my bank wanted 10% "for me" ha ha.
